## Formula sandbox tuning

User-supplied formulas in Gridmoor execute inside a restricted interpreter with hard ceilings on time, memory, and call depth. Reviewers should confirm any change to these ceilings is justified in the PR description, since raising them widens the abuse surface. Defaults were chosen from production traces. The current limits are as follows.

limits module of tafog-fawip:
WEIGHTS = {
    "julix": 57,
    "lamys": 992,
    "kasvan": 209,
    "quenok": 750,
    "alddor": 259,
    "oliath": 1009,
    "wenix": 815,
}

Each constant
// below bounds a specific abuse vector — recursion depth prevents
// stack exhaustion, the step budget stops runaway loops, and the
// allocation ceiling guards shared heap space on multi-tenant nodes.
// These values were validated against the adversarial corpus from the
// Brindlehaven red-team exercise; any adjustment requires a rerun of
// that suite before tagging a release. The approved limits follow.

tuning constants:
BUDGETS = {
    "druath": 240,
    "lamwyn": 180,
    "silael": 275,
}

## Log Sampling — Murmurbird Service

Murmurbird emits ~40k log lines/min at baseline. Full retention is off. Sampling: 100% of errors, 10% of warns, 1% of info, keyed on request hash so related lines survive together. Change rates only via the sampling config repo; hand edits on hosts are reverted hourly. Sampled-out lines are counted, not stored, so dashboards stay accurate. Every deployed sampling config is traceable to the build token recorded below.

pipeline stamp: htk9_ce63042d9